        "content": "<p>Domestic sea freight from January to November 2010 reached 9.9 million tons, a 27.2 percent decrease compared to the same period last year, the Central Statistics Agency (BPS) reports.<\/p>\n<p>According to BPS data, Panjang, Lampung and Surabaya\u2019s Tanjung Perak ports saw a 14.4 percent and 5.2 percent decline in sea freight during this period. In contrast, Makassar, Tanjung Priok and Balikpapan seaports experienced a 29.3 percent, 19.3 percent and 1.7 percent increase.<\/p>\n<p>However, the director of sea freight traffic at the Transportation Ministry, Leon Muhammad, questioned the BPS data samples, saying it may have only been taken from larger city ports.<\/p>\n<p>However, Leon said, a decline took place in international sea freight due to a weakening regional economy early last year, kontan.co.id reports.<\/p>",
